Pakistan confirms Kardar as governor

pakistanflag

Shahid Kardar has been appointed as the new governor of the State Bank of Pakistan the central bank said on Thursday.

The son of a former test cricket captain, Kardar has served a lengthy career in public services spanning 30 years. His career has included a spell as finance minister of Pakistan's Punjab region from November 1999 to January 2001.
